2001 Acura Integra vs. 2001 Chevrolet Corvette

To start off, both 2001 Acura Integra and 2001 Chevrolet Corvette were released in the same year (2001).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 5,970 cc (8 cylinders), 2001 Chevrolet Corvette is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Chevrolet Corvette (395 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 200 more horse power than 2001 Acura Integra. (195 HP @ 5600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2001 Chevrolet Corvette should accelerate faster than 2001 Acura Integra.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Chevrolet Corvette weights approximately 175 kg more than 2001 Acura Integra.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2001 Chevrolet Corvette is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2001 Chevrolet Corvette.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2001 Acura Integra,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Chevrolet Corvette (543 Nm) has 367 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Acura Integra. (176 Nm). This means 2001 Chevrolet Corvette will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Acura Integra.

Compare all specifications:

2001 Acura Integra 2001 Chevrolet Corvette
Make Acura Chevrolet
Model Integra Corvette
Year Released 2001 2001
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1799 cc 5970 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 195 HP 395 HP
Engine RPM 5600 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 176 Nm 543 Nm
Engine Compression Ratio 10.6:1 11.0: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Drive Type Front Rear
Number of Seats 4 seats 2 seats
Vehicle Weight 1575 kg 1750 kg
Vehicle Length 4530 mm 4440 mm
Vehicle Width 1720 mm 1850 mm
Vehicle Height 1380 mm 1250 mm
Wheelbase Size 2630 mm 2810 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 65 L 68 L
